Output 29ba26316bcb11f7f7232a3b255a6c7cd70af6956a3ddb423d15ad3d627a4dbc:2

value
18791558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e49b81f43f719255334d008a790ef674e2e72c2 OP_EQUALVERIFY OP_CHECKSIG
address
12JYmnfYU2ghzjwUAspzJsSnmJtK9bZPYR
transaction
29ba26316bcb11f7f7232a3b255a6c7cd70af6956a3ddb423d15ad3d627a4dbc
spent
true